Career Opportunities in Fisheries Compliance Management
Compliance Officer | Responsible for ensuring that fisheries adhere to regulations, focusing on sustainable practices and legal requirements. |
Policy Analyst | Evaluates and develops policies related to fisheries management, incorporating environmental and economic factors. |
Fisheries Inspector | Conducts inspections to verify compliance with fishing regulations and ensures the protection of aquatic resources. |
Marine Conservation Officer | Works to protect marine ecosystems and enforce laws related to marine life and fisheries sustainability. |
Data Analyst | Analyzes data on fish populations and compliance rates to inform management decisions and policy development. |
